Leeds United remain keen on Shea Charles, but progress has been slow and a Premier League rival could now escalate the race. They have yet to match Southampton’s valuation, and talk of a deal being close is wide of the mark, though hope remains for an agreement.
According to the Daily Mail, Fulham are preparing an offer worth £24m, with new manager Alvaro Arbeloa keen to bring the 22-year-old to Craven Cottage. The report adds that talks are expected to advance and that Southampton want £25m plus add-ons.
Fulham have been mentioned as a potential rival this summer, with Crystal Palace also linked to the Northern Ireland international. Publicly revealing readiness to bid would offer little advantage to Fulham, and such information would most likely benefit Southampton by encouraging competition. Saints are minded to maximise value, not least because Manchester City retain a 15 per cent sell-on clause.
Charles was left out of the win at non-league neighbours Eastleigh on Saturday, and his absence was not believed to be transfer-related. He returned to pre-season later than many team-mates after representing Northern Ireland in two June friendlies.
Leeds are currently in the USA for pre-season, with games to come against Wrexham, Sunderland and Liverpool. The club have added signings mid-camp in previous summers and have medical facilities at home and across the Atlantic to finalise a deal.
